WT1和β-catenin蛋白在非小细胞肺癌中的表达及意义

摘要: 目的 探讨肾母细胞瘤基因1(WT1)和β-链蛋白(βcatenin)在非小细胞肺癌(NSCLC)组织中的表达情况,分析两者与临床病理特征的关系以及两者表达的相关性。
方法采用免疫组化En Vision二步法检测WT1和βcatenin蛋白在48例NSCLC组织中的表达情况,以20例癌旁组织作对照。结果 WT1蛋白在NSCLC和癌旁组织中的阳性表达率分别为62.5%和10.0%(P<0.05),β-catenin蛋白在NSCLC和癌旁组织中的异常表达率分别为72.9%和15.0%(P<0.05)。WT1蛋白表达与淋巴结转移有关,而与性别、年龄、肿块直径、病理类型、组织分化和pTNM分期均无关(P>0.05);β-catenin蛋白异常表达与组织分化有关(P<0.05),而与性别、年龄、肿块直径、pTNM分期、淋巴结转移和病理类型均无关(P>0.05)。NSCLC中WT1蛋白与β-catenin蛋白表达呈正相关(r=0.331,P<0.05)。结论 WT1和β-catenin蛋白可能与NSCLC的发生、发展有关。

Abstract: Objective To investigate the expressions of Wilms tumor 1 (WT1) and βcatenin protein in nonsmall cell lung cancer (NSCLC), and analyze their relationship with clinicopathological characteristics and the correlation between the two proteins. Methods A total of 48 paraffin-embedded tissue samples from NSCLC patients were stained by En Vision two steps method to evaluate the expressions of WT1 and β-catenin protein, and 20 adjacent normal tissues were collected as control. Results The positive rate of WT1 protein was 62.5% in NSCLC, higher than 10.0% in adjacent normal lung tissue (P<0.05). The aberrant expression rate of β-catenin protein was 72.9% in NSCLC, higher than 15.0% in adjacent normal lung tissue (P<0.05). The expression of WT1 protein was related to the status of lymph node metastasis(P<0.05), but not with gender, age, tumor diameter, pathological types, histological differentiation or pTNM staging(P>0.05). There was significant difference between βcatenin protein aberrant expression and histological differentiation(P<0.05), while no differences were found in gender, age, tumor diameter, pathological types, status of lymph node metastasis or pTNM staging(P>0.05). WT1 protein was positively related to β-catenin protein in NSCLC(r=0.331,P<0.05).
Conclusion The expressions of WT1 protein and β-catenin protein may be correlated to the occurrence and development of NSCLC.
